Transaction 784a898b150e237051cf7c0883253ae2e447aa62bcded8a0450ccfd067590cb3
1 Input
1 Output
-
784a898b150e237051cf7c0883253ae2e447aa62bcded8a0450ccfd067590cb3:0
- value
- 362231
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50fb812fe0dd71b08f201a9c54b35471c409b5c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18PCMCJpuiisDo8WU4rRvHB2em5pPWytPX